Birth Certificates in Boone
Birth certificate requests in Boone are handled through the Watauga County Courthouse at 842 W King Street, where the Register of Deeds maintains comprehensive vital records. Whether your child was born at Watauga Medical Center or you’re an Appalachian State University family needing documentation, the courthouse provides efficient service for all county residents. Mountain families from Banner Elk, Blowing Rock, and smaller High Country communities also rely on this central office. The courthouse staff understands the unique needs of university families and seasonal residents who may require expedited processing for academic or employment purposes. Proper identification and relationship documentation ensure smooth processing of all birth certificate requests in this mountain community.
Requirements
Valid government ID, payment, proof of relationship to person named on certificate
Who Can Request
The person named on the certificate, their parent/legal guardian, spouse, child, grandparent, sibling, or authorized legal representative with proper documentation.

Marriage Licenses in Boone
Mountain couples planning ceremonies at venues like Chetola Resort, the Daniel Boone Inn, or scenic outdoor weddings along the Blue Ridge Parkway obtain their marriage licenses at the Watauga County Courthouse. The courthouse location on West King Street serves couples from throughout the High Country region. North Carolina requires a 60-day waiting period after application before the ceremony can take place, so advance planning is essential. Appalachian State students and faculty often choose Boone for their weddings, taking advantage of the area’s natural beauty and convenient courthouse services.
Requirements
Both parties present with valid ID, certified copies of divorce decrees if previously married, 60-day waiting period in NC

Death certificates for Watauga County residents are processed through the Register of Deeds at the courthouse on West King Street. Families working with local funeral establishments or handling estate matters can obtain certified copies for insurance, legal, and financial purposes. The mountain location serves families throughout the High Country, from Boone proper to surrounding communities in the Blue Ridge region.
Requirements
Valid ID, proof of relationship or legal authority
Who Can Request
Spouse, parent, child, sibling, grandparent, legal representative of the estate, funeral director, or anyone with a documented legal or personal interest.

Divorce Decrees in Boone
Divorce records from Watauga County proceedings are available through the courthouse Register of Deeds office. The staff maintains comprehensive records of all county divorce cases and provides certified copies for legal, financial, and personal purposes. Having case numbers helps expedite searches, though records can be located using party names and timeframes when specific case information isn’t available.
Requirements
Valid ID, case number helpful

The Watauga County Courthouse is located at 842 W King Street in downtown Boone, operating Monday through Friday typically from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. Downtown parking can be challenging during university events and peak tourist seasons, so arrive early or use the courthouse parking deck. The office accepts cash, checks, and credit cards for vital record fees. During busy periods like Appalachian State graduation or leaf season, allow extra time for processing. Staff members are familiar with university requirements and can provide guidance for students needing documents for study abroad or graduate school applications.
